Greek water polo teams drawn for Olympic qualifiers

Greek water polo teams drawn for Olympic qualifiers

The draws for the 2020 Olympic water polo qualification tournaments were held, and Greece’s men’s and women’s national teams will be aiming to qualify for this summer’s Olympics in Tokyo.

The women’s qualification tournament will be held from March 8-15 in Trieste, Italy. This means that Italy will have hosted the event three of the last four times, as they also did so in 2008 and 2012. The Greek women will be aiming to qualify for the Olympics for the first time since 2008, after missing out in 2012 (despite being the reigning world champion), and in 2016 (losing on penalties to eventual bronze medalist Russia in the qualification tournament). 

Greece have been drawn into Group B with Hungary, Israel, New Zealand, and a team from Asia (TBA). In Group A will be host Italy, France, the Netherlands, Slovakia, and another team from Asia (TBA). The two semifinal winners will then punch their tickets to Tokyo, after the controversial decision to include a weak South Africa team in the Olympic tournament, thus reducing the number of available qualification spots from three to just two for the women’s event. Greece, Hungary, Italy, and the Netherlands are expected to be the main contenders for Olympic qualification in Trieste.

The men’s qualification tournament will be held in Rotterdam, the Netherlands, from March 29-April 5. The Greek men will be aiming to extend their Olympic qualification streak to 11, having qualified for every Olympics from 1980 on.

Greece were drawn into Group A with Brazil, Canada, Georgia, Montenegro, and a team from Asia (TBA). In Group B will be the Netherlands (host), Argentina, Croatia, Germany, Russia, and another Asian team (TBA). Unlike the women’s event, the men’s tournament will see three teams qualify for the 2020 Olympic tournament via the qualification tournament in Rotterdam. This number was originally set to be four teams, but has since been reduced to three after South Africa were gifted an Olympic berth in the men’s event as well. Croatia, Greece, and Montenegro are expected to be the three teams earning Olympic qualification in Rotterdam.

WOMEN’S DRAW:

Group A: France, Italy, Netherlands, Slovakia, TBA Asian team

Group B: GREECE, Hungary, Israel, New Zealand, TBA Asian team

MEN’S DRAW:

Group A: Brazil, Canada, Georgia, GREECE, Montenegro, TBA Asian team

Group B: Argentina, Croatia, Germany, Netherlands, Russia, TBA Asian team
